Delaware State University senior Mallory Ross is off to a strong start to the 2008 cross country season. Ross was the only Hornet runner in the Top 70, finishing 18th in the Towson University Baltimore Metro at Oregon Ridge Park Friday afternoon.
Delaware State was eighth in the team standings with 232 points. Johns Hopkins was the top team with 44 points. Ross completed the 5,000-meter course in 19-minutes-39 seconds.
Katie Radzik was the individual winner with a time of 18:03. Nykesha Sowell was the next Delaware State runner to cross the finish line, coming in 75th place with a time of 22:49.
